In order to ensure the safety of religious people’s lives and property, Puqi Town actively carried out flood control and anti Taiwan work in the religious field. The Office of the People’s Religious Affairs, together with the village religious affairs team, grid members and three members in the church, increased patrols, focusing on the comprehensive inspection of places that are prone to landslides, low-lying areas and long construction time, and organized scientific and orderly transfer of personnel in advance. The inspection team led a team to visit key places such as Nanmen Church, Jiqing Temple, Ying’en Palace and mountain side places, and checked the “double suspension” of places during the typhoon, building safety, fire safety and typhoon prevention preparations. The person in charge of the site is required to fully understand the importance of flood control and typhoon fighting, not be careless, improve the flood control emergency plan, improve the emergency response capacity, strictly implement the “double suspension”, and put the safety of religious people first; After the typhoon, the epidemic prevention and health work shall be comprehensively carried out, and the place shall be disinfected and ventilated. From September 13 to 14, the town carried out a comprehensive inspection of 53 religious (folk belief) sites under its jurisdiction, with 65 inspectors and 19 people being persuaded to leave.
